For the following quote, what type of figurative language is being used?

“There was such a glory over everything, the sun came like gold through the trees, and over the fields, and I felt like I was in heaven.”

Respuesta :

yikeskatie
yikeskatie yikeskatie
  • 09-06-2021

Answer:

simile

Explanation:

simile because there's the word "like" being used
